Zechariah 6:3-13

3 the third chariot white horses, and the fourth chariot dappled gray horses.
4 Then I said to the angel who talked with me, "What are these, my lord?"
5 The angel answered me, "These are the four winds of heaven going out, after presenting themselves before the Lord of all the earth.
6 The chariot with the black horses goes toward the north country, the white ones go toward the west country, and the dappled ones go toward the south country."
7 When the steeds came out, they were impatient to get off and patrol the earth. And he said, "Go, patrol the earth." So they patrolled the earth.
8 Then he cried out to me, "Lo, those who go toward the north country have set my spirit at rest in the north country."
9 The word of the Lord came to me:
10 Collect silver and gold from the exiles—from Heldai, Tobijah, and Jedaiah—who have arrived from Babylon; and go the same day to the house of Josiah son of Zephaniah.
11 Take the silver and gold and make a crown, and set it on the head of the high priest Joshua son of Jehozadak;
12 say to him: Thus says the Lord of hosts: Here is a man whose name is Branch: for he shall branch out in his place, and he shall build the temple of the Lord.
13 It is he that shall build the temple of the Lord; he shall bear royal honor, and shall sit upon his throne and rule. There shall be a priest by his throne, with peaceful understanding between the two of them.
